JetBlue is offering free flights to the families of the victims of Sunday’s mass shooting in Orlando. The company is also waiving fees for some customers.

49 people were killed and over 50 injured when Omar Mateen opened fire at the nightclub Pulse. Mateen was shot and killed by police.

In a blog posting the airline stated, “This weekend’s events are felt by all of our 19,000 crewmembers, many of whom live in, work from and travel through Orlando – one of our focus cities – at Orlando International Airport, our Orlando Support Center and JetBlue University.”

To help the victims of the tragedy the company is proving free seats on its available flights to and from Orlando for the immediate family and domestic partners of the victims killed or injured.

Those family members and domestic partners requiring travel assistance can contact 1-800-JETBLUE for details.

JetBlue also announced they will waive fees for any customer traveling to or from Orlando who need, or want, to make last-minute changes in their travel plans in the wake of the tragedy.

For crew-members impacted by the event JetBlue activated resources to assist.

The company plans to make a charitable contribution to support the victims and their families.
